Oceana Canada

Oceana Canada has met with MPs 25 times since January 2024, reaching 15 MPs across 6 parties. Most recent contact: June 3, 2026.

25 meetings since 202473 all-time15 MPs6 parties100% by in-house staff

What they're asking for

In the registry's own words. Descriptions are only filed for meetings since mid-2024.

  1. Advocating for modernizing the Fisheries Act and policies to be inclusive of Indigenous Knowledge Systems, ecosystem-approaches and climate change.

    June 3, 2026 · Elizabeth May · Green Party · Fisheries

  2. Advocate for the batching of certain stocks under the new rebuilding regulations and implementing rebuilding plans.

    April 27, 2026 · Mel Arnold · Conservative · Fisheries

  3. Advocate for the implementation of the precautionary approach framework for forage fish stocks.

    April 27, 2026 · Elizabeth May · Green Party · Fisheries

  4. Advocating for improvement to fisheries and shipping measures that will protect North Atlantic right whales. This includes changes to regulations under the Fisheries Act and Canada Shipping Act.

    February 24, 2026 · Jaime Battiste · Liberal · Fisheries; Transportation; Animal Welfare

  5. Policies to support a circular economy in Canada.

    February 10, 2026 · Patrick Bonin · Bloc Québécois · Environment

  6. Advocating for harmful chemicals to be eliminated from plastics used in food packaging.

    August 12, 2025 · Julie Dabrusin · Liberal · Environment
